Taxonomic Classification

Rank Green cockscomb Maned sloth
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Saxifragales (Saxifragales) Pilosa (Sloths & Anteaters)
Family Crassulaceae Bradypodidae (Three-toed Sloths)
Genus Sedum Bradypus (Three-toed Sloths)
Species Sedum praealtum Bradypus torquatus
